Transaction 8421e36db81d22c96b24adbdac24c680aedf64719dd64d381c7fc4c5bf9df034

1 Input
2 Outputs
  • 8421e36db81d22c96b24adbdac24c680aedf64719dd64d381c7fc4c5bf9df034:0
  • value  28726
    address  1Kabd1NkgKkM99dCz2qzQQf6RW1S66QHjF
  • 8421e36db81d22c96b24adbdac24c680aedf64719dd64d381c7fc4c5bf9df034:1
  • value  1172864
    address  159ghRixJdCHCKLj3yJSYhtMUpwzPnVPDU